NGC 4825 is a lenticular galaxy located in the constellation of Virgo. The NGC is a catalog of 7,840 nebulae, star clusters, and galaxies. Here are the key stats on NGC 4825:
NGC: | NGC 4825 |
Type: | galaxy |
Galaxy type: | lenticular |
Galaxy morph class: | E-S0 |
Constellation: | Virgo |
Surface brightness: | 23.7 mag/arcsec2 |
V-mag (visual): | 11.5 |
B-mag (blue): | 12.8 |
J-mag (IR): | 9.47 |
H-mag (IR): | |
K-mag (IR): | 8.77 |
Right Ascension: | 12:57:12.24 |
Declination: | -13:39:53.40 |
Major axis: | 2.69 ' |
Minor axis: | 1.64 ' |
Angle (major axis): | 139° |
Radial velocity: | 4326 km/s |
Redshift: | 0.01454 |
Right Ascension (RA) units = HH:MM:SS.SS
Declination (Dec) units = DD:MM:SS.SS
